HYBRID - Analyst I Clinical Info Sys (Epic Certified)
Bronson Healthcare is a compassionate and resilient organization that is dedicated to providing exceptional patient care. They are seeking an Epic Clinical Information Systems Analyst I responsible for the selection, design, implementation, support, and maintenance of clinical information systems to enhance patient care activities.

Responsibilities
Support and participate in the research, planning, installation, configuration, testing, troubleshooting, maintenance and upgrade of applicable systems
Analyze and evaluate present or proposed business procedures or problems to define data needs
Corrects routine and non-routine computer malfunctions or works with other IT staff, Department Users, System Coordinators and Vendors to correct individual problem situations and restore service
Develops and maintains collegial relationships and regular communication with all Department Users, System Coordinators, IT staff and Vendors as relates to systems in area of responsibility
Understand the choices involved in application specifications
Investigate and analyze end user preferences and business operations while making build decisions
Analyze new application functionality in releases to determine how it could be used
Develop and document internal procedures to use in conjunction with the applications
Work with report writers to ensure that the application has the necessary reports
Keeps abreast of developments in the information systems and communications field and evaluates developments for applicability or incorporation into existing applications
Evaluates systems, processing, and development needs and recommends additional equipment or new systems
Participates in resolutions during outages or periods of degraded system performance
Participates in the preparation and authoring of supporting documentation, instruction manuals, and audit trails of program changes in accordance with systems and programming standards
Supports and maintains the technical literature library and the related system
Participate in the planning, development, implementation, maintenance, and evaluation of clinical information systems
Maintain a current understanding of the processes involved in these activities
Collaborate with information technology, customer and vendor teams in the evaluation of development efforts, in planning the pilot and full implementation of new systems and/or new features, and in processing user feedback and requests
Maintain a detailed understanding and working knowledge of the current clinical information systems, their functions, and their relationship to other Bronson information systems
Participate in the process of revising and implementing changes in both the automated and manual components of the clinical information systems
Provide proactive user support of the clinical information systems, working with the System Coordinators, Physician Informaticist, Nurse Informaticists, and clinical leadership
Participate in analysis and research related to clinical information systems
Qualification
Required
Bachelor's degree (or an equivalent combination of education and experience) required
Current clinical licensing and/or certification (or progress toward certification completion) if applicable
Applicable Epic application certification (e.g. Inpatient, Ambulatory) required or must complete certification within 6 months of hire
Working knowledge of healthcare operations in inpatient and/or ambulatory setting required
Demonstrated pro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ite
Ability to work with end users to determine software specifications, hardware requirements, and process improvement workflows
Ability to create system documentation, project plans, test scripts and education materials
General familiarity of end user business practices, concepts, terminology sufficient to support the applications in a healthcare delivery environment
Good customer service skills with the ability to communicate both orally and in writing
Must be able to interact with customers from various levels in the organization to gather the information necessary to understand, address, and document their data needs
Must consistently negotiate and act on deliverables and timeframes with stakeholders, take ownership of issues, and respond to issues within expected timeframes
Preferred
Experience with Epic or other enterprise clinical information systems preferred
